The biggest thing with any vehicle setup is repeatable results. That means that it’s always the same. The only way you can have the board be the same anywhere you setup the car or race, is to have it be level. So yes, a slightly un-level board may not influence setup much, but sometimes tenths of a degree or tenths of a mm can have large effects on the car. The only way to repeat an exact setting on the car is with a leveled board.

That said, I personally don’t worry about getting my board too level. I will however move the car 180° on the board and measure again to ensure I have parity in my measurements.
